The Most Popular Thai Cocktails for Festivals

When it comes to celebrating festivals, Thai cocktails bring a burst of flavor and excitement to the occasion. Known for their unique blend of ingredients and refreshing taste, these cocktails are perfect for festivals that embrace joy and community. Here’s a look at some of the most popular Thai cocktails that are sure to elevate any festive gathering.

1. Thai Basil Mojito

The Thai Basil Mojito is a delightful twist on the traditional mojito. This cocktail combines fresh Thai basil leaves with lime juice, sugar, and soda water, delivering a refreshing and aromatic drink. The addition of Thai basil not only enhances the flavor but also gives a fragrant touch, making it a favorite during summer festivals.

2. Sangria Thai Style

This vibrant cocktail incorporates the beloved elements of traditional Spanish sangria but with a Thai spin. Red or white wine is blended with chopped tropical fruits like mango, pineapple, and lychee, along with a splash of soda and a hint of Thai herbs. The result is a sweet, fruity drink that’s ideal for socializing at outdoor festivals.

3. Mango Sticky Rice Martini

Inspired by the iconic Thai dessert, the Mango Sticky Rice Martini is a feast for the senses. Combining vodka, mango puree, coconut cream, and a touch of glutinous rice syrup, this creamy cocktail captures the essence of the popular dish. This unique drink is often a topic of conversation at festivals, as it surprises and delights attendees with its distinctive flavor.

4. Thai Green Tea Cocktail

This health-conscious option brings together the earthy notes of Thai green tea with vodka and a splash of lemon juice. The Thai Green Tea Cocktail is light yet flavorful, making it perfect for those looking to enjoy a refreshing drink without too much sweetness. Its unique flavor profile pairs well with Thai street food, making it a must-try at food festivals.

5. Cha Chim

Cha Chim, or Thai iced tea cocktail, is a beloved drink that merges the rich taste of Thai iced tea with spirits, typically rum or whiskey. The tea, sweetened and creamy, creates a beautifully layered drink that is not only delicious but visually appealing. This cocktail is perfect for festive occasions where guests can enjoy the full-bodied flavors of tea and spirit.

6. Lychee Martini

The Lychee Martini is a popular choice among festival-goers, primarily due to its sweetness and floral notes. This cocktail features vodka and lychee puree, garnished with a fresh lychee fruit or a slice of lime. Its lightness makes it an excellent pairing for spicy Thai cuisine, making it a festive favorite.

7. Thai Chili Margarita

If you’re looking for a cocktail with a bit of a kick, the Thai Chili Margarita is the way to go. Blending tequila with fresh lime juice, honey, and muddled Thai chili peppers, this drink balances heat and sweetness beautifully. It’s a bold choice that will certainly spice up any festival gathering.
